How about another WellNails polish tonight?  WellNails (an Indie Polish from Denmark and the sister brand to Foxy Paws that I reviewed previously) The North Pole is a Real Place - inspired by the creator's favorite sitcom - How I Met Your Mother.



WellNails The North Pole is a Real Place



The North Pole is a Real Place is described by the maker as follows:

'The North Pole is a real place' comes in a milky white base and is filled with white, ice cold glitter - both hexes and squares - and micro iridescent glitter. Making it appear as frosty snow on your nails.

Actually, it's so cool that your fingers become icy blue at night, when the temperature drops! Just like the at the North Pole... Which is a real place, you know?!
I've found the inspiration for this polish from the episode 'Legendaddy'. Robin is dating a marine biologist, who tells her he's going to the North Pole for a couple of months. So she makes fun him and says, that he doesn't have to make up pretend-worlds if he wants to dump her... And so he does ;) 

The formula and application were great. I layered one easy coat over a plain white base with one light coat of Poshe top coat for the photos.  And it glows under blue light! (I used an accent nail of purple to show that it works over other colors besides white in some of the photos. I wish I could remember WHICH purple.) As you well know by now, I am not a photographer. So to get the awesome blue light photos, I sacrificed some photo quality. Sorry, I don't know how to do both!
